How To Choose The Best Drip Irrigation For Flower Beds

Flower beds are not uniform rows of identical vegetables — they mix perennials, annuals, and shrubs with varying water needs. The right kit delivers precise moisture to each plant without flooding delicate blooms or leaving shallow-rooted flowers parched. Here are the key factors to consider before buying.

Tubing Diameter and Flow Capacity

The mainline tubing diameter governs how much water reaches the far end of your bed. Standard 1/4-inch tubing works for short runs but loses pressure after about 30 to 40 feet. Kits with a 5/16-inch or 1/2-inch mainline carry water farther with stable flow, allowing you to branch into multiple 1/4-inch feeder lines. For a medium flower bed (roughly 50 to 100 square feet), a 1/2-inch mainline is the most forgiving option.

Emitter Type and Adjustability

Flower beds benefit from adjustable emitters that can switch between a gentle drip for tender annuals and a wider spray for dense ground cover. Misting nozzles cool the air and work well for delicate foliage, while vortex emitters deliver a targeted stream that soaks the root ball without wetting petals. Kits that include at least two emitter types give you the flexibility to match watering style to each plant.

Connector Quality and Leak Resistance

Barbed fittings are the traditional standard, but they require force to insert and can pop loose under pressure changes. Push-to-connect fittings use O-rings and locking clips to create a tight seal without tools. For any kit, look for brass or reinforced plastic connectors at stress points — these resist cracking after a season of sun exposure and thermal expansion.

Component Quantity vs. Coverage Needs

A 50-foot kit with 16 emitters covers a modest flower bed, while a 230-foot kit with 65 pieces handles multiple large beds. Count the emitters and stakes against the number of plants you need to water. Buying a kit with extra tees and couplers is far cheaper than sourcing individual parts later, especially if you plan to expand next season.

Hardware & Specs Guide

Tubing Diameter and Wall Thickness

The outer diameter of the mainline dictates how much water volume the system can carry before pressure drops. Standard 1/4-inch tubing (OD 0.25″) is fine for short runs under 30 feet. 5/16-inch tubing (OD 0.3125″) increases flow by roughly 55% over 1/4-inch, making it suitable for medium beds. 1/2-inch tubing (OD 0.5″) is the heavy lifter, supporting runs over 50 feet with minimal pressure loss. Wall thickness also matters — thin-wall tubing kinks easily during installation, while thick-wall polyethylene resists crushing and UV degradation longer.

Emitter Flow Rate and Pressure Compensation

Emitter flow rates are measured in gallons per hour (GPH). Common rates for flower bed emitters range from 0.5 GPH (slow drip for tiny annuals) to 2.0 GPH (faster delivery for established shrubs). Pressure-compensating (PC) emitters maintain the same flow regardless of inlet pressure or elevation changes — essential for sloped beds. Non-compensating emitters are cheaper but produce uneven flow at the high and low ends of a run. Most premium kits use PC technology, while budget kits rely on simple orifice drippers.

FAQ

What tubing diameter works best for a 50-foot flower bed?
For a 50-foot straight run, a 1/2-inch mainline tubing is recommended to maintain adequate pressure at the far end. 1/4-inch tubing will experience significant flow drop beyond 30 feet, leading to weak watering at the end of the bed. If you must use 1/4-inch tubing, split the bed into two shorter zones fed from a central 1/2-inch line.
Can I connect a drip irrigation kit to a hose timer for automatic watering?
Yes, most kits are compatible with standard hose-end timers. Look for kits that include a faucet adapter with standard 3/4-inch hose threads. For systems with high flow rates (over 200 GPH), ensure the timer’s valve is rated for the required volume. Some budget timers restrict flow and may reduce system performance — a brass-bodied timer with a large internal bore is preferred.
How often should I clean or replace the emitters in my drip system?
Emitters with metal nozzles (brass or copper) typically need cleaning once per season by soaking in vinegar to dissolve mineral deposits. Plastic emitters may clog more frequently, especially if your water source has high sediment or hardness. An inline filter rated at 100 to 150 mesh catches most debris and extends emitter life significantly. Replace clogged emitters immediately rather than trying to unclog them — the effort rarely restores full flow.
Is misting irrigation better than drip irrigation for flower beds?
Misting systems cool the air and deliver water to the foliage, which benefits heat-sensitive flowers like impatiens and fuchsia. However, wet foliage increases the risk of fungal diseases such as powdery mildew and botrytis. Drip irrigation delivers water directly to the root zone, keeping leaves dry and reducing disease pressure. For most flower beds, a combination of drip emitters for root watering and occasional misting for cooling is the ideal approach.
